Voyage Yachts - Los Gatos

Hi all: While in the Bahamas during January and February we observed a Voyage Yacht of about 40 to 50 feet pull up and drop the anchor in the anchorage just west of Fort Montague. I was surprised to see a young lady doing everything by herself and even more surprised to see she was alone on the vessel with 2 very young daughters whom she called "her team." A couple days later, with a few waves and pointing of an arm, I helped her navigate to a position just off Rose Island where she dropped anchor and took her team ashore. Later that evening the wind came up and the yacht dragged the anchor towards the island and after a couple of attemps and a bit of struggling, she accepted my offer to help and another fellow from on the island and myself helped get her hooked and I took a dive light and had a swim on her anchor to make sure she was safe to which one of the team exclaimed "Look Mommie, he has an underwater torch!" We chatted the next day when she explained that they had purchased the vessel in Fort Lauderdale and she had single handed this far, with some help from the team, and was going on to George Town to meet her husband. I was impressed with her fortitude and easy going outlook. Her and my wife are the two extremes I think.
I would very much like to know that she made it to her destination all well and secondly, we would like to stay in touch with them if at all possible.
